As we dive into this year’s Wimbledon festivities, a look at the standout fashion statements can’t be missed. Among the highlights is Olivia Rodrigo, who made a stunning Wimbledon debut. The young star turned heads in a playful red and white gingham midi dress paired with a matching handbag, perfectly embodying the “It-Girl” aesthetic. Not to be outdone, the effortlessly chic Eve Hewson was spotted on day three, sporting a classic pinstriped outfit complemented by a glass of Champagne Lanson. This chic styling exemplifies the elegant yet casual vibe that permeates the event, inviting everyone to dress to impress while enjoying the matches.

Couple goals were epitomized in the fashionable choices of Priyanka Chopra and Nick Jonas. Priyanka's high-neck white midi dress and heels meshed beautifully with Nick's sophisticated ensemble featuring cream trousers and a navy blue double-breasted jacket. This fashion-forward duo showcased an understanding of formal attire, balancing comfort and style. In a similar spirit of sophistication, Tom Daley emerged in a sage green tailored suit, accented by chunky loafers and a standout Christian Louboutin clutch. This refreshing take on men’s style added an air of modernity to the traditional setting of Wimbledon.
The fashion scene didn’t stop there; it was evident that attendees were keen to showcase their style while remaining cool in the summer heat. Jade Holland Cooper made a striking impression with her stylish ensemble consisting of a mismatched striped blazer and trousers, topped off with a spotted tie. In the midst of the audience, Cate Blanchett managed to maintain her chic demeanor with a baby blue tartan suit and trendy aviator sunglasses, all while enjoying the day with her portable fan. Meanwhile, model Mia Regan demonstrated a playful approach to the dress code in a charming striped pleated skirt and blazer combination enhanced by mid-calf socks and heels—a perfect nod to Wimbledon’s blend of tradition and modern fashion.

As the event unfolded, more stylish figures emerged from the crowd, each making their mark. Molly-Mae opted for a khaki midi dress and pointed-toe pumps, showcasing a refined elegance that turned heads among spectators. Rebel Wilson embraced a vibrant look on day two, debuting a broderie anglaise midi dress in pink that was both chic and playful. The allure of all-white ensembles also took center stage with Sophie Hermann, who donned a seamless look from head to toe, finishing off her attire with ballet flats and a basket bag filled with strawberries. These fashion choices not only spoke to the event's atmosphere but also highlighted personal styles that onlookers are eager to emulate.
Royal presence always brings an air of dignity, and Princess Beatrice of York attended in a stylish blue and white cropped shirt adorned with floral shoulder accents, showcasing how to dress for a summer event while keeping cool. Meanwhile, legendary footballer David Beckham proved that men's fashion deserves its share of attention, appearing dapper in a cream-toned linen suit. His effortless style demonstrates that fashion can indeed be gender-neutral at high-profile events, making a statement that men can and should embrace fashionable choices just as passionately.

The trend of coordinated outfits caught on among attendees too. Laura Whitmore showcased a butter yellow wide-leg trouser and matching blazer ensemble that resonated with summer vibes. Angela Scanlon took a matching co-ord approach in pink and white stripes, a look that pays homage to the classic Wimbledon strawberries and cream. In stark contrast to traditional attire, actress Bella Priestley opted for a deep brown bandage dress, effortlessly proving that the event allows room for more daring stylistic choices that push the boundaries of typical tennis fashion.
Heidi Range made waves in her leopard print maxi dress cinched at the waist with a chic Hermès belt, demonstrating that adopting bold prints can be both playful and fashionable. Tennis champion Maria Sharapova stepped onto the scene in a more relaxed but luxurious outfit—a denim skirt paired with a navy shirt—alongside patent brown mules, showing how former players can retain a stylish presence even off the court. Completing the list of fashionable guests was Dame Joanna Lumley, who embraced the power of animal print with leopard print trousers, matching them with a crisp white shirt and sensible flats.
